Governor Gavin Newsom wants to reign-in free healthcare for illegal immigrants. California is facing a roughly two-billion-dollar deficit for the coming fiscal year. In an effort to help reduce that, Newsom wants to cap the healthcare the state is giving the undocumented. People 19-years and older living in California illegally will no longer be allowed to sign up for the state’s Medi-Cal health coverage starting in 2026. Children and teens will still be eligible. Newsom also says illegal immigrants already on Medi-Cal will have to start paying a 100-dollar monthly premium beginning in 2027. Newsom’s office says this will save taxpayers nearly five-and-a-half-billion dollars by 2028.
